Reading and Leeds Tickets on March 30th

Wednesday, March 4th, 2009

If you didn’t buy your Reading or Leeds tickets back in September, when the initial batch of tickets was released for 2009 after the 2008 event, then March 30th may be an important day for you.

The tickets will be released for the 2009 event on March 30th at 7pm. As usual, the line-up will be announced moments before the ticket release. Ticket types and prices will be announced closer to the ticket release date.

Reading and Leeds takes place over the August bank holiday which, this year, falls on the 28th, 29th and 30th August.

Pendulum Confirmed for New Scottish Festival

Thursday, February 12th, 2009

Drum and bass outfit Pendulum have been confirmed for another new festival for 2009, Homecoming Festival. Scotlands newest festival will take place over the May Bank Holiday weekend (Saturday 2nd and Sunday 3rd May) at Irvine Beach Park, Aryshire.

The headlining acts are still to be announced but the current bands on the bill announced so far includes Tim Westwood, Taio Cruz. Utah Saints, Dimitri From Paris and Armin Van Buuren. The festival organisers have also confirmed DJ sets from The Pigeon Detectives and Snow Patrol.

Grant Ruxton, Homecoming’s organiser, told the press: “Homecoming is an ambitious five year festival programme. If you are impressed by what you see in May 2009, then we would say that this is only the beginning. West Central Scotland is possibly the only area in the UK that does not stage a major high quality outdoor music festival.”

The Irvine area is undergoing a huge regeneration and we are delighted to be part of the project. We are thrilled to have secured some of the hottest acts around for our first year and will be offering festival goers a diverse and exciting line up. There are many acts still to be announced so watch this space.”

Homecoming Festival is just one of a series of events being held to celebrate the anniversary of the birth of Scotland’s National Poet, Robert Burns – who would be turning the grand age of 250!

Early bird weekend tickets were put on sale today priced at a modest £85. These will be available until 10th March when single day passes (£55) will go on sale. Homecomig will feature 12 areans and the organisers claim the festival finishes later than all other major Scottish festivals.
